Your Impact on Our Patient Experience (Responsibilities):
- Work alongside the dentist during a variety of dental procedures, ensuring patients feel comfortable and cared for
- Prepare treatment rooms, sterilize instruments, and maintain equipment following IPAC and infection-control standards
- Take and process dental X-rays, impressions, and other lab procedures
- Greet and prepare patients for appointments, complete chart audits, and provide clear oral hygiene instructions in simple terms
- Support the front office team with booking, invoicing, and patient follow-ups when needed
- Maintain accurate patient records and assist with administrative tasks
- Keep the sterilization area organized and ensure all IPAC protocols are consistently followed
- Contribute positively to the team and perform additional duties as assigned
What You Bring to Our Team (Qualifications):
- Required: Certified Dental Assistant (CDA) Level II with active HARP Certification.
- Required: A minimum of 2 years of hands-on experience as a Dental Assistant.
- Required: Valid CPR/First Aid and IPAC Certifications.
- Excellent interpersonal and communication skills with a talent for making patients feel comfortable.
- Strong knowledge of dental procedures and confidence in discussing treatment plans with patients
- Strong attention to detail and proven time management abilities.
- Organized, detail-oriented, and able to manage time effectively in a busy clinic setting
- Asset: Previous experience using TRACKER dental software.
